New projects of Uzbekistan on efficient use of water resources

President of Uzbekistan Shavkat Mirziyoyev gave the order to build 10 mudflow reservoirs to improve irrigation of 50 thousand hectares of land.

Uzbekistan will continue concreting canals to reduce water losses, allocating 800 billion soums for this in 2025. The President proposed building micro hydroelectric power plants by increasing the flow rate in concreted canals.

Construction of reservoirs to improve irrigation of 50 thousand hectares of land in Uzbekistan

  • President of Uzbekistan Shavkat Mirziyoyev gave the order to build 10 mudflow reservoirs to improve irrigation of 50 thousand hectares of land. This was reported by the presidential press secretary Sherzod Asadov.
  • The head of state held a meeting on the efficient use of water and energy resources in agriculture. The meeting discussed the collection and use of spring and autumn flood waters for irrigation.
  • “For example, 36 million cubic meters of water are annually wasted inefficiently from the stream flowing through the mahallas of “Honnazor”, “Chorlok”, “Kurgon”, “Shovona” and “Kiykim” in the Koshrabat district,” the president noted.
  • According to him, if a small reservoir is built here, it will be possible to develop 2.5 thousand hectares of land, provide the population with new plots for intensive vegetable cultivation, employ 4 thousand unemployed people and lift 600 families out of poverty.
  • The construction of such reservoirs in the Kashkadarya, Namangan, Surkhandarya and Tashkent regions, as well as in nine districts of Fergana, will improve the irrigation of 50 thousand hectares of land.

Scope of PBG slabs

Intended for the construction and strengthening of the banks of artificial and natural watercourses and reservoirs, strengthening the slopes of road embankments, strengthening the slopes of protective and regulatory structures, for the protection of underwater pipeline crossings, protection of the bottom of port water areas, additional protection of cable routes laid through water barriers, construction of temporary flood protection fortifications, protection of dam crests and dams from erosion during overflow, construction of canals.

Advantages of PBG slabs

  • The ability of the coating to take the shape of the protected surface without additional bending moments;
  • Flexible concrete coating can be laid on the protected surface without preparation, directly on the ground;
  • The coating design has sufficient deformability, ensuring its tight fit to the ground, which minimizes the volume of water under the coating, which can migrate from areas with increased pressure to adjacent areas;
  • The use of synthetic materials as reinforcement eliminates the destruction of flexible slabs due to corrosion;
  • All coatings are factory-made, which reduces the cost of installation work and allows you to monitor the quality products.
  • Certified products manufactured in factory conditions at specialized plants under strict quality control and representing finished products, do not require additional operations at the place of their use.
  • Resistant to ice impacts, impacts of driftwood, objects carried by the current and other mechanical impacts;

Characteristics of PBG

  • Length - 2240 mm.
  • Width - 1050 mm.
  • Height - 100 mm.
  • Concrete class - B40

Reinforcement made of polypropylene rope with a breaking force of 5000 kg.
